This Proto-Scythian entry contains reconstructed terms and roots. As such, the term(s) in this entry are not directly attested, but are hypothesized to have existed based on comparative evidence.

Proto-Scythian[edit]

Etymology[edit]

From Proto-Iranian *čárma.

Noun[edit]

*cārma n

  1. skin

Descendants[edit]

  • Ossetian:
    Digor Ossetian: царм (carm)
    Iron Ossetian: цар (car)
  • Khotanese: [script needed] (tcārman)
